Punctuate with Perfection will bring you from your current level of punctuation ability to perfection. Would you like to write in a clearer, more authoritative fashion? Do you want to know exactly how to use colons, semicolons, dashes, and hyphens? This book can help you answer all these questions and more.
This book is a modern guide which doesn’t get overly technical with jargon or complex explanations. Yet it is detailed and thorough, so you can acquire the confidence of using all the punctuation explained within. Every punctuation mark is shown in action using interesting and varied examples. There are also exercises to complete, which will help ingrain each punctuation mark and its uses.

In this book, you’ll learn:

• how to write more clearly by selecting the right punctuation mark for its intended purpose.

• how to never again appear sloppy or amateurish in your written English.

• the exact function and uses of the colon, the semicolon, the apostrophe, scare quotes, single quotes, double quotes, parentheses, the em-dash, the en-dash, the hyphen, and many more common punctuation marks.

• the many second and third uses of common punctuation marks.
